Fan-out backpressure for the Quillet notifier: when the queue depth crosses the soft limit, the dispatcher sheds low-priority pushes and batches the rest at 500ms intervals. Reviewer should confirm the shed counter is exported and that retries respect the jitter window. Once merged, the release artifact gets re-signed by the pipeline, which expects the deploy key shown below.

deploy key for bawep-yawif: bky6_GQhaSt

Hi Marisol — welcome aboard. Quick heads-up before you dive in: the Brightvale campaign budget was trimmed 18% last quarter, so the Q3 media plan for Lumora Teas needs reworking. Devi in creative has the revised numbers. Agency contracts are month-to-month now, so flexibility is on our side. One more thing you should see before your first leadership sync.

board note of bawep-tajef: Queniusek Systems plans to raise the Quenvan list price by 53.1 percent in March. The pricing group signed off on a budget of $176.4 million for Project Drueth. The renewal with Casionix Partners closes at $142.5 million a year, 8.3 percent below the last contract. Project Fraax slips by six weeks because of the tooling delay.

Subject: Discount Policy for Large Deals

Team, ahead of Darla Vennick joining as director, please review the revised discount framework for Orvatek enterprise deals. Any discount above 18% on contracts exceeding 500 seats now requires two executive approvals and a margin impact worksheet. Exceptions will be rare and documented. The rationale connects to our broader plans, summarized below.

confidential, kagup-bafog: Fraaxax Group is in early talks to buy Soroxox Group for about $343.8 million. The Olidor launch date is June 14, and nothing goes to the press before then. Legal wants the Aldmirek Logistics term sheet signed before July 23.

MEMO — Renewal of Castellane Supply Agreement

To branch managers: our contract with Castellane Fabrication expires at the end of May. Procurement has negotiated a two-year renewal with a 3% price increase, improved delivery windows, and a volume rebate above agreed thresholds. No changes to ordering procedures are required. Please flag any recurring quality issues to regional procurement by the 15th. Background relevant to the renewal appears in the confidential note below.

board note of tadup-tajog: Headcount on the Oliiel team goes from 31 to 88 by the end of February. Gross margin on Oliiel came in at 62 percent against a plan of 29 percent.